Worth grading only if it gems

A PSA 10 Jaylen Wells #14 brings $166 versus $118 raw — a $48.08 spread that covers an economy-tier ~$25 grading fee. A PSA 9 ($84.32) sells for less than raw, so anything short of a 10 loses money.

Break-even by outcome and fee

Jaylen Wells #14: net result of grading versus selling raw, by outcome and fee tier
If it comes back…Sells forEconomy / bulk (~$25.00)Standard (~$50.00)Express (~$150)
Gem — PSA 10$166+$23.08−$1.92−$102
PSA 9$84.32−$58.18−$83.18−$183
PSA 8$34.00−$109−$134−$234

Net = sale price − $118 raw value − fee. Fee tiers are illustrative; plug your grader's current price into the calculator below.

Which grader pays the most — and what a 10 takes

All centering standards
Jaylen Wells #14: top-grade value by grading company with centering tolerance
Grader10 sells forvs bestFront centering for a 10Back
BGS 10$215best55/4570/30
PSA 10$166−$49.4255/4575/25
CGC 10$99.00−$11655/4575/25
SGC 10$99.00−$11655/4575/25

Tolerances are each company's published centering standard for its top grade; surface, corners and edges must also be clean. Centering is the one you can measure yourself before you pay.

How much is a PSA 10 Jaylen Wells #14 worth compared with raw?

A PSA 10 Jaylen Wells #14 (Basketball Cards 2024 Panini Mosaic Stained Glass) sells for about $166 versus $118 for a raw near-mint copy — a 1.4× premium as of Sep 4, 2026.

Which grading company is best for Jaylen Wells #14?

By resale value, BGS 10 leads at $215, ahead of PSA 10 at $166. Fees and turnaround differ, so the best-paying label is not always the best net.

What centering does Jaylen Wells #14 need for a BGS 10?

BGS publishes 55/45 front and 70/30 back centering as the tolerance for a 10 (Gem Mint). Off-center copies are capped below the top grade regardless of surface — measure yours before paying the fee.
